The man under the cosh all season was Russell Westbrook. The off-season trade of Westbrook did not result in good fortunes for the Lakers. Instead, they have had their struggles and Russ West has had one of the worst seasons in his career.

NFL legend Shannon Sharpe once again expressed his frustrations over the Russ West trade happening in the first place. However, he also went berserk, reacting to Magic Johnson, suggesting that ‘Brodie’ should stay at the Lakers for one more season.

Sharpe said, “They make it seem like Frank Vogel didn’t try to make it work, but when the process of trying to make something work, someone has to be amenable to that.”

“When Russ signed up. He had to be willing to accept being the third option. Russ is unwilling to accept that. It’s LeBron, AD, Russ. Russ has never had to be a third option. If you want to make it with Russ, you’re going to probably need to move LeBron. Put the ball in Russ’ hands and say, Russ, play like you did at Washington. Play like you did at OKC after KD left.”

“Other than that, Skip, I don’t see how it works. How many more years does Magic think he has of LeBron? You’ve just wasted your 19th. Are you willing to waste your 20? Because, Skip, I don’t see how Russ works,” he added.

Skip Bayless reacts to Magic Johnson’s suggestion about Lakers and Russell Westbrook

Skip Bayless explained why Russ West is untradeable. He said, “I believe you’re missing Magic’s point. His point is that Russ is untradeable, which has been my point to you from day one.”

Bayless added that Westbrook was a disaster this season and teams saw that and that is what will make it difficult for the Lakers to trade him.

“The rest of the league knows how bad he has degenerated into being because he has lost some of his athleticism. He’s now 33, he’s about to play year 15 and his numbers fell dangerously,” said Skip Bayless.

The Los Angeles Lakers are in search of positivity. One of the worst seasons in their history is behind them. Now it’s time for the Lakers to come back stronger next season. They failed to qualify for the playoffs and couldn’t even qualify for the play-in tournament.

An impressive individual season from LeBron James was not enough to end their season with some success. The Lakers would hope they can sort out the things soon so that they can start preparing for a successful next season.
